I hate makedbz.

Ron Jarrell jarrell at solaris.cc.vt.edu
Fri Jul 27 02:59:00 UTC 2001

Ok, so this is the first time I've had to regenerate a history file since 2.2.
What is *with* makedbz?  I've got an 853 meg history file after makehistory
ran.  The old file had a bit over 16m entries in it, so a did a makedbz -s 20000000 -f
history.n (leaving room for the fact that the server's been down now since early wed.
morning, so I'm going to have to deal with a huge surge of backlog).

Doing the makehistory, re-reading the entire spool, and building the ovdb files
took 6 hours.  In 20 more minutes the makedbz, which just has to build the offset
index into the history.n file, is going to hit 24 hours, and still going strong.  The io
rates are very reasonable, there's about 3.5 gig of memory free on the system, 
and the other two processors are twiddling their thumbs.

By now I could have built another news system, fed the entire spool over there, 
reinitialized this one, and fed it all *back*...

